ATAD2 Upregulation Promotes Tumor Growth and Angiogenesis in Endometrial Cancer and Is Associated with Its Immune Infiltration

Figure 5

Upregulation of ATAD2 promotes tumor growth and angiogenesis. (a) Transplant tumor growth in mice after injection of ATAD2 overexpression, knockdown, and control of endometrial cancer cells. (b–d) Expression of ATAD2, VEGF, and MVD in knockdown ATAD2 tumors. (e) Mouse transplant tumor growth curve. (f) Immunohistochemical images corresponding to knockdown of ATAD2 (magnification, 200x). (g) The picture of immunohistochemistry of transplanted tumor when ATAD2 was overexpressed above (magnification, 200x). (h–j) Overexpression of ATAD2 increases the expression of VEGF and MVD in transplanted tumor models.
